Hiking around Crookham Village reveals a landscape characterized by a lowland mosaic of natural features. The area offers diverse terrains, including tranquil canal towpaths, mixed woodlands, and open fields. Notable features include the Basingstoke Canal and the ecologically rich Fleet Pond Nature Reserve, providing varied scenery for outdoor activities. The region's paths cater to different fitness levels, from leisurely strolls to more moderate hikes.

Not far from Baseley Bridge on the Basingstoke Canal, you can catch a glimpse of this beautiful bronze horse statue and it peacefully munches the lawn. The cottage behind it is exquisite as well, with a fantastic thatched roof and timbering on show. Combined with the common sight of ducks padding about the grass, it's quite the picturesque spot.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many hiking trails are available in Crookham Village?

Crookham Village offers a good selection of hiking trails, with 15 routes currently available. These range from easy strolls to more moderate hikes, catering to various fitness levels.

Are there family-friendly hiking options in Crookham Village?

Yes, Crookham Village has several family-friendly hiking options. The area's flat canal towpaths, particularly along the Basingstoke Canal, are ideal for leisurely walks. Additionally, trails around Fleet Pond Nature Reserve are generally flat and well-maintained, with some sections accessible for buggies and wheelchairs, making them suitable for families.

Can I bring my dog on the hiking trails in Crookham Village?

Many trails in Crookham Village are dog-friendly, especially those along the Basingstoke Canal and through woodlands and fields. However, it's always recommended to keep dogs under control, particularly in nature reserves like Fleet Pond, to protect wildlife. Please be mindful of local signage regarding dog policies.

Are there circular hiking routes around Crookham Village?

Yes, many of the hiking routes in Crookham Village are circular, allowing you to start and end in the same location. Popular examples include the Tundry Pond – Sprats Hatch Bridge loop from Crookham Village and the Pond With Swans and Ducks loop from Crookham Village.

What natural features or landmarks can I expect to see on a hike?

Hiking around Crookham Village offers a diverse landscape. You'll encounter the tranquil Basingstoke Canal with its historic WW2 pillboxes and quaint brick bridges, the serene Tundry Pond, and the ecologically rich Fleet Pond Nature Reserve, Hampshire's largest freshwater lake. Trails also wind through mixed woodlands and open fields, showcasing the area's lowland mosaic character.

Are there any waterfalls near Crookham Village?

The landscape around Crookham Village is characterized by canals, ponds, and woodlands, but it does not feature natural waterfalls. However, the area offers beautiful waterside walks along the Basingstoke Canal and around Tundry Pond and Fleet Pond.

What are the trail conditions like in different seasons?

Trail conditions vary by season. In drier months, paths are generally firm and pleasant. During winter or after heavy rain, some sections through woodlands and fields can become muddy, adding to the variety of the hiking experience. The canal towpaths and main trails around Fleet Pond are typically well-maintained year-round.

What are some notable attractions or points of interest near the hiking trails?

Beyond the trails, you can explore the Crookham Village Conservation Area with its historic buildings. Nearby natural attractions include Hawley Lake and Horseshoe Lake, offering additional scenic spots. For those interested in local history, remnants of World War II, such as pillboxes, can be spotted along the Basingstoke Canal.
